The Short Answer (For Those Who Like Their Information Like Their Miniskirts: Short and Sweet)
The flight from Oakland to Las Vegas is a blink-and-you'll-miss-it kind of affair. We're talking about a breezy 1 hour and 22 minutes on average for a nonstop flight. That's less time than it takes to watch the safety video and place your first in-flight bet on whether the pilot will make a pun about turbulence.
Yes, you read that right. Vegas, baby, Vegas is practically in your backyard (assuming your backyard has a runway and a questionable smell of jet fuel).

But Wait, There's More! (Because Life Isn't Always Nonstop Flights)
Of course, the world isn't always filled with perfectly scheduled nonstop flights. There might be a quick layover here or a detour to refuel in Boise there. But fret not, even with a little rerouting, you're still looking at a travel time in the ballpark of 2-3 hours.
